Bioplastic Market Has Great Potential

As some of the plastic manufacturers in the world have turned to the development of bio-plastics, experts expect that in the next few years the global production of bioplastics will grow at a faster pace.

According to the European Bioplastics Association's relevant statistical data, by 2010, the global production of bioplastics is about 700 thousand tons. It is expected that in 2011 it will exceed 1 million tons. By the year of 2015, the global production of bioplastics is expected to reach 1.7 million tons.

The investment advisor of the chemical industry Yi Chi said that, as petrochemical-based plastics use non-renewable sources of raw materials, they are difficult to degrade in the natural state and they have a greater degree of environmental pollution and damage to human health and other disadvantages, the development and production of renewable, low-carbon and environmentally friendly bio-plastics has become the development trend of the plastic industry.

The relevant information shows that An American technology company Maili in the early 2011 in Lake Providence, Louisiana, has begun to build the world's largest bio-based succinic acid plant. Netherlands Plunk is expected to start the construction of lactic acid plant with a capacity of 75,000 tons / year in Thailand in the second half of 2011.

Compared to petrochemical plastics, bioplastics have obvious advantages. The average annual growth rate of the global bioplastics industry is up to 20%. It is expected in the next few years it will maintain a rapid growth trend and the market potential is huge.

Despite the recent global economic downturn and escalating debt crisis in Europe and America have a negative impact on consumption and investment, but the bio-plastics industry is full of optimism. In addition, the pattern of global production in the next 10 years will also have a radical change. In the next few years, Thailand is expected to become the hub of bio-plastics industry. Bio-resistant plastics will gradually become the main market force.

Despite the average annual growth of the global bio-plastics industry is 20%, but the market share in the entire plastics industry is only 0.1%, which means that the bio-plastics market has great potential. The average annual growth rate will continue for years. Currently bioplastics investment projects are in full swing. Although Europe is the largest bio-plastics market, but most new production facilities will be established in other regions, particularly in Asia and South America. Thailand is expected to become the bio-plastics industry hub in the coming years.
